In Hungary, you can find several types of sweets, and we really love consuming these. And now, we can officially (and proudly) say that one of the world’s best chocolate product is Hungarian.

Maybe you have already heard about The Chocolate Show, where there is always a prestigious professional competition, International Chocolate Awards, where the best chocolates are awarded. Well, this year, chocoMe got its second gold medal there, so the best nut and milk chocolate sweet is officially Hungarian.

The gold medallist product is part of the Raffinée family: the Raffinée Piemonte hazelnut, covered in ground Ethiopian Harrar coffee and hazelnut flavoured milk chocolate. Sounds good?
